Question | Advice-Needed Mugging on Beach Rd between Waterfront and Sea Point walkway

12 Upvotes

Today my wife and I walked the entire promenade from the south all the way to the waterfront, mainly for exercise and to check out a couple shops. On the way back just past Haul Rd, a small man or older child approached us on the sidewalk and said something like "Hello Miss". We didn't acknowledge him right away but within a split second he violently grabbed my wife's neck and snatched her necklace, before sprinting away. We didn't even have time to process what was happening as it all took place in under 1 second.

In hindsight, we likely shouldn't have had any jewelry on, even though it was brass and not gold. We are from Canada and read about areas to avoid, but we're certainly shaken when this happened and right around many other tourists.

Is it advisable for us to file a police report or just move on and try to enjoy the remainder of our trip? Thanks!
